Settling:-

Before your child begins with us we suggest you visit together, meet the staff and become familiar with the routine of the day. This gives you time to ask questions and helps your child to see what is expected. Settling in is a very important pare of learning. Sensitively approached, your child will gain confidence and feel secure. If your child becomes distressed we w ill contact you, so it is important to leave your contact number.

Key person :-

On joining your child will be allocated a key worker, who will be happy to liase with you concerning progress during their time with us. The key person will normally be available as you collect your child, for consultation.

Parent’s participation:-

The Pre-School is managed by a committee; there is an open invitation to all parents to attend meetings. These are normally held once a term, the staff will advise when the next one is due. Any parent can become involved, and volunteer to become an officer, or serving member.
Parent helpers/ volunteers are very welcome in sessions.

Photographs:-

The staff will regularly take photos of the children to inform profiles, and to evidence development during activities. These may be displayed in the setting from time to time.

Confidentiality:-

Any information that you share with us regarding your child or family situation will be treated with confidence and will be kept securely. Information relating to Child Protection issues will be shared with the relevant authorities.
